Meet Stephanie

Stephanie Neshcov, a Registered Psychotherapist (Qualifying), takes a person-centered approach, empowering clients to guide their sessions and focus on their unique strengths. She believes in the importance of recognizing one's capabilities and fostering self-confidence throughout the therapeutic process. Stephanie’s personal experience in therapy has shaped her practice, deepening her appreciation for the power of understanding and support in overcoming life’s challenges. In her sessions, clients can expect a collaborative and compassionate space to explore their emotions and discover solutions. Stephanie has a special interest in helping those who feel isolated or stuck, offering tools for connection and confidence-building. She invites anyone seeking clarity and support to reach out and begin their journey toward healing and self-discovery.

Does Stephanie offer direct billing with my insurance? Or how does payment work?

First Session charges each session directly to your credit card. Once each session occurs, and your card is charged, you will receive a PDF receipt to your email with all of the details you will need to get reimbursed (therapist name, license/designation, license number, address, etc). You can then submit the receipt to your insurance company for reimbursement.
